Icelandair and Emirates have signed a Codeshare Agreement that will allow customers to seamlessly travel across the two airlines' networks, opening new and exciting travel corridors. The flights will be available for sale from 1st September 2024, subject to securing regulatory approvals.

The agreement will greatly increase both airlines' offerings for convenient connections where customers can travel on a single ticket and have their luggage checked through all the way to the final destination. Icelandair passengers in North America and Iceland can connect eastbound via Emirates' network to Dubai; and Emirates worldwide passengers can connect westbound via Icelandair's network to Iceland. Icelandair and Emirates expect to further develop and expand the partnership in the future.

Bogi Nils Bogason, Icelandair president and CEO:

"We are very pleased to announce Emirates, the largest airline in the Middle East, as our 7th global airline codeshare partner. We have and will continue to expand our network of partner airlines, focusing on working with airlines that offer great service and connectivity. Emirates' extensive network will open exciting and convenient travel opportunities for our customers and we very much look forward to the expanded cooperation."

Adnan Kazim, Emirates' Deputy President and Chief Commercial Officer commented:

"We're pleased to partner with Icelandair and offer our customers access to new and exciting destinations beyond our own network. Iceland is an incredibly popular destination with stunning natural landscapes, making the island an aspirational destination for leisure travellers. We look forward to our new partnership with Icelandair and are positive it will grow further to offer even more connectivity and options for travellers."
